It has been a good year for the British turntable manufacturer, with two What Hi-Fi Best Buy awards just received today. The brand had already won a best buy award in the 2010 reviews for the impressive Rega RP1, and it has retained its title in this year's awards, being the best turntables up to £400 by some margin. 

The upgrade to the Planar 3 turntable series; the new Rega RP3, has similarly won an award clinching the best turntable in the £400-£1000+ category. The attractive sleek designs of Rega RP1 and RP3 turntables has certainly added to the brands appeal, but it is the quality of the components which has set the brand ahead of the competition.
